Women's Pay
Measured by pay, women with full-time jobs now make 78.2 percent of what men earn, up from about 64 percent in 2000.  CBS news Sept 11

UPS – High Tech Training Techniques
UPS, the world's largest package-delivery company, is expected to hire 25,000 new drivers over the next 5 years to replace a large number of retiring Baby Boomers. To train these new recruits, UPS has developed a variety of new training tools. Behind the wheel of a virtual UPS delivery truck, drivers identify and avoid obstacles, such as kids suddenly darting into the street, or parked cars. Drivers must be able to park a truck and retrieve one package in 15.5 seconds, and they are trained on a "slip and fall machine" that simulates walking when conditions are icy or wet.  Wall Street Journal

Net Price Calculator – a "game changer"
By Oct. 29, 2011, all US colleges and universities that provide federal financial aid are required to have a Net Price Calculator on their website. These online devices will offer students customized approximations of college costs based on their family size, financial status, etc. Daniel Lugo, dean of admission and financial aid at Franklin and Marshall College, called the calculator a "game-changer" for families. "It's been very hard for students to figure out bottom-line costs. Now they can."  NY Times 9-9-11

College Retention Rate
Over the past two years, approximately 2/3 (67%) of all first-year students at US two and four-year colleges returned to the same institution for their second year of school.  ACT Jan 2011

2010 Annual Salaries by Education Level
No high school diploma $23,000
High school graduate $32,500
2-Year College graduate $40,000
4-year college graduate $54,500
Source: Bureau of Labor Statistics

Roughly one in four married-couple household has a stay-at-home mom. That's down from nearly half of such households in 1969.  CBS News

Roughly one of every five stay-at-home parents is a father.  CBS News

Halloween is the 2nd highest grossing commercial holiday after Christmas.
